uniapp-native-plugin
Develops native Android and iOS plugins for uni-app including module creation, JavaScript-to-native communication, and plugin packaging for distribution. Use when the user needs to build custom native modules, extend uni-app with native capabilities (camera, Bluetooth, sensors), or create publishable native plugins.
